Caley Thistle’s Dominance

As February unfolded, Caley Thistle showcased their prowess in League 1, with standout performances that have significantly impacted the league 1 table. The team’s success is largely attributed to the remarkable contributions of player Alfie Bavidge.

In a series of matches, Bavidge scored crucial goals, including victories over East Fife and Hamilton Accies. His consistent performance was further highlighted when he netted a goal in the 1-1 draw against Stenhousemuir, demonstrating his ability to perform under pressure.

With these contributions, Bavidge has amassed an impressive total of 20 goals in all competitions for Caley Thistle. This achievement not only underscores his talent but also cements his position as a key player for the team.

As of now, Caley Thistle stands at the top of the league 1 table, a position they have maintained through a series of strong performances. Their current form has also propelled them into the final of the KDM Evolution Trophy, marking a significant milestone in their season.
